Hwacheon Sancheoneo Ice Festival
The Hwacheon Sancheoneo Ice Festival is one of the best winter festivals in the world. It is held in South Korea and features ice fishing and other winter activities. In 2011, CNN placed the festival in the "7 Wonders of Winter" list.
This event is a family friendly affair that attracts more than a million visitors each year. Visitors can enjoy various programs including ice fishing and bare hand fishing, as well as snow and ice sports. They also have the option of enjoying cultural exhibitions and singing and dancing performances.
During the festival, the Hwacheoncheon Stream, a river that freezes in winters, becomes a huge pond covered with a thick layer of ice. Hundreds of people fish for sancheoneo. To catch this type of trout, you can either jump into the freezing water or use a plastic rod and a bait.
Hwacheon Sancheoneo Ice festival is open to the public from January 7 to January 29. It is the most popular festival in Korea and is one of the top four ice festivals in the world.
